Crafting Believable Non-Player Characters in Chicken Road Games

Crafting Believable Non-Player Characters in Chicken Road Games

Creating immersive gaming experiences depends significantly on designing Non-Player Characters (NPCs) that players find believable and engaging. In Chicken Road Games, NPCs serve as more than just background figures; they play crucial roles in storytelling, mission delivery, and enhancing the gameplay atmosphere. The central question in crafting these characters is how to make them relatable and realistic to maintain player engagement. This article delves into effective strategies for designing believable NPCs that can transform the gaming experience.

Developing Unique Backstories for NPCs

A well-crafted backstory adds depth to an NPC, making them intriguing participants in the game world. By giving NPCs rich histories, developers can weave them seamlessly into the narrative, providing players with reasons to interact beyond mere gameplay necessity. Begin by outlining the character’s past experiences, motivations, and relationships within the game world. This not only adds layers to their personality but also defines their connection to the player and the overarching story.

An effective backstory for NPCs in Chicken Road Games should include:

  1. Identity and Personality: Determine their role in the game: are they allies, mentors, or adversaries? Define their personality traits that align with their roles.
  2. History and Experiences: Outline significant past events that have shaped who they are.
  3. Current Motivations: Understand what drives them at present and how that aligns with player interactions.

Incorporating Dynamic Interactions

Static NPCs can quickly become predictable and lose their charm. To maintain interest, it’s essential to integrate dynamic interactions within Chicken Road Games. These interactions should adapt based on players’ actions and decisions, offering unique dialogues or quests. By utilizing branching dialogues, developers can create a diverse range of responses, tailored to the player’s character choices and actions in the game chicken road casino game.

Implementing dynamic interactions involves the use of:

  • Adaptive Dialogue Trees: Allow for multiple conversation pathways based on player choices.
  • Behavioral Changes: NPCs should modify their behaviors and attitudes depending on the player’s actions.
  • Evolving Storylines: Design quests and narratives that change with player decisions.

Enhancing Emotional Engagement

Emotionally engaging NPCs can turn a gaming session into a memorable experience. In Chicken Road Games, emotions are captured through storytelling, voice acting, and visual expressions. To create emotional connections, ensure that NPCs display authentic responses and emotions that players can relate to. It’s crucial for game designers to make NPCs not only believable but also responsive to the player’s emotional state, thus enriching the interaction.

Consider applying these techniques to boost emotional engagement:

  • Consistent Voice Acting: Use voice actors to convey emotions accurately, adding depth to interactions.
  • Expressive Animation: Develop animations that capture a character’s mood and reactions effectively.
  • Story-Driven NPC Arcs: Craft subplots that allow players to witness the NPC’s growth and transformation.

Integrating Realistic NPC Behavior

Realism in NPC behavior transforms a digital experience into a lifelike adventure. NPCs should follow lifelike routines, react logically to environmental changes, and exhibit authentic responses to player interactions. In Chicken Road Games, achieving this level of realism requires the artificial intelligence to be smart enough to analyze and respond meaningfully to the game’s stimuli. This can be achieved using complex AI scripts that mimic real-world behavior patterns.

A well-programmed AI should include:

  1. Routine Scheduling: Set daily and seasonal routines to make NPCs behave like real inhabitants of the game world.
  2. Contextual Reactions: Enable them to react appropriately to immediate dangers or changes in the environment.
  3. Hierarchical Decision Making: Equip them to prioritize tasks according to their personality and role.

Conclusion

Crafting believable non-player characters in Chicken Road Games is a multi-faceted challenge that involves detailed planning, creative storytelling, and meticulous programming. By designing NPCs with rich backstories, dynamic interactions, emotional depth, and realistic behaviors, game developers can significantly enhance player immersion and satisfaction. As the complexity of games grows, so does the importance of creating NPCs that are more than mere tools, but are integral, lively components of the gaming experience.

FAQs

What makes a non-player character believable?

A believable NPC has a comprehensive backstory, dynamic interactions, emotional depth, and behaves in a realistic manner, adapting to the game environment and player’s choices.

Why is it important to have non-static NPCs?

Static NPCs can make the game world feel repetitive and unengaging. Dynamic NPCs adapt to the player’s actions, making gameplay more interactive and personalized.

How can a backstory enhance NPC design?

A backstory provides depth to an NPC, making them part of the game’s narrative and giving players a greater reason to engage and interact with them.

What role does AI play in NPC behavior?

AI is crucial for creating realistic NPC behaviors, enabling them to adapt and respond to environmental changes and player interactions in a lifelike manner.

How do emotions contribute to player-NPC interaction?

Emotions allow players to form connections with NPCs, making the game more immersive and memorable through realistic and relatable interactions.